The Hanoi to Sapa journey covers 320 km through northern Vietnam

Hanoi to Sapa is 320 km through Vietnam’s northern mountains, with three main transport options: sleeper bus (5-6 hours, $14-30), overnight train to Lao Cai then bus (8-10 hours, $25-60), or limousine van (5 hours, $20-35). Each has trade-offs in price, comfort, and timing. Quick Comparison

  • Sleeper Bus: 5-6 hrs | $14-30 | Most popular, best value.
  • Limousine Van (9-15 seater): 5 hrs | $20-35 | Comfortable, faster.
  • Train + Bus: 8-10 hrs | $25-60 | Most scenic, classic experience.
  • Private Car: 5 hrs | $120-200 | Most flexible, group only.

1. Sleeper Bus (Most Popular)

Inside a Vietnamese sleeper bus with passengers
Sleeper buses are the most common Hanoi to Sapa transport.

Best Operators

  • Sapa Express — reliable mid-range with reclining beds.
  • Inter Bus Lines — backpacker favorite, double-decker.
  • Eco Sapa — quality service, comfortable beds.
  • Queen Cafe Bus — budget option.
  • Green Bus — tourist-friendly with English staff.

Cost & Schedule

  • Standard sleeper: 350,000-500,000 VND ($14-20).
  • Premium sleeper (cabin/private): 500,000-750,000 VND ($20-30).
  • Daytime departures: 7:00 AM, 8:00 AM, 11:00 AM (less common).
  • Night departures: 7:00 PM, 9:00 PM, 10:00 PM, 11:00 PM (most popular).
  • Pickup: My Dinh Bus Station, central hostels, hotel pickup available.

Pros

  • Direct Hanoi → Sapa center.
  • Save night accommodation if night bus.
  • Cheapest direct option.
  • Reclining beds in newer fleet.

Cons

  • Mountain switchbacks last hour can cause motion sickness.
  • Limited toilet stops.
  • Hard to truly sleep.
  • Tall passengers cramped.

2. Limousine Van

9-15 seat mini-vans with reclining seats. Faster than full-size bus and more comfortable.

Top Operators

  • Sapa Discovery Limousine
  • Sapa Express Limousine
  • Asia Limousine

Cost & Schedule

  • Standard limo: 450,000-650,000 VND ($18-26).
  • Premium VIP limo (recliner): 600,000-850,000 VND ($24-34).
  • Frequency: 5-8 daily departures.
  • Pickup: Hotel pickup standard, small premium for door-to-door.

3. Train + Bus

Shuttle bus on winding mountain road
Mountain switchbacks await on the final approach to Sapa.

The classic overnight train route. Hanoi → Lao Cai (8 hours) → bus to Sapa (45 min uphill).

Train Classes & Costs

  • Hard Seat: $20-25. Uncomfortable for 8 hours.
  • Soft Seat: $25-35. Reclining.
  • Hard Sleeper (6-berth): $30-45. Budget sleep option.
  • Soft Sleeper (4-berth): $40-65. Most comfortable standard.
  • Tourist Train (Victoria, Pumpkin, Livitrans): $50-130. Premium private cabins, modern dining car.

Schedule

  • SP1: Departs Hanoi 9:35 PM. Arrives Lao Cai 5:30 AM.
  • SP3: Departs Hanoi 10:00 PM. Arrives Lao Cai 6:00 AM.
  • SP5: Departs Hanoi 8:30 PM. Arrives Lao Cai 4:30 AM.

Bus from Lao Cai to Sapa

  • Mini-bus shuttle: 50,000-100,000 VND ($2-4). 45-60 min.
  • Taxi: 250,000-350,000 VND ($10-14).
  • Booked transfer: Often included with tourist trains.

4. Private Car

$120-200 each way. 5 hours direct. Best for groups of 4-7. Door-to-door, multiple stops.

Which Should You Choose?

Tight Budget Solo Backpacker

Sleeper bus night. $14-20.

Couple/Comfort-Focused

Limousine van or premium sleeper bus. $20-30.

Romantic/Once-in-Lifetime

Tourist train (Victoria/Pumpkin) for the experience. $80-130.

Family/Group of 4-6

Private car. $120-200 split equals $20-50 per person.

Returning to Hanoi for Early Flight

Day bus (8 AM departure) or limousine van.

Booking Tips

  • Book sleeper buses 24-48 hours ahead in high season.
  • Book train sleepers 1-2 weeks ahead for weekend departures.
  • Tourist trains sell out quickly — book 2+ weeks ahead.
  • Avoid Tet (Lunar New Year) — everything triples in price.
  • Compare prices — 12go.asia vs Klook vs operator websites.
  • Save confirmation — email and screenshot.

What to Pack for the Journey

  • Warm layer for arrival (Sapa is 10°C cooler than Hanoi).
  • Motion sickness pills for buses.
  • Power bank.
  • Snacks and water.
  • Toiletries and toilet paper for trains.
  • Sleep mask and earplugs.
  • Cash for taxi/shuttle from Lao Cai.

Hanoi to Sapa FAQs

How long is Hanoi to Sapa?

320 km. 5-6 hours by bus. 8-10 hours by train + bus.

Best transport option?

Sleeper bus for value. Limousine van for comfort. Tourist train for experience.

Are there flights to Sapa?

No direct flights. Closest airport is in development at Sa Pa but not yet operational. Most travelers fly to Hanoi then bus/train.

Is the road dangerous?

Modern highway most of the way. Last 30 km has switchbacks but driver experience is high.

Is the train safer than the bus?

Generally yes — trains have lower accident risk.

Can I bring luggage?

Yes — both bus and train accommodate normal luggage.

Should I tip drivers?

Not expected but appreciated. 20,000-50,000 VND ($1-2) for great service.

How early should I book?

Sleeper bus: 24 hours. Train: 1-2 weeks. Tourist train: 2+ weeks.
